The Master of Arts in Teaching-Reading and Language Arts program primarily serves working classroom educators who address literacy development across various age groups. This graduate program equips teachers with strategies to manage diverse classroom sizes, from small groups to larger classes exceeding 40 students. Participants can pursue additional Michigan certifications as Classroom Reading Teachers (BT), Language Arts Instructors (BX), or Reading Specialists (BR) through this program. While all endorsements share a common foundational curriculum, Oakland University can only certify candidates for one specialization per completed course sequence. Each endorsement path has distinct course requirements and elective choices. To obtain state certification, candidates must successfully finish all required coursework and pass Michigan's designated endorsement examination.
